- The distance between Tripoli, Peloponnese, Greece and Nitchequon, Quebec, Canada is approximately 6,959 km or 4,324 mi.
- To reach Tripoli, Peloponnese in this distance one would set out from Nitchequon, Quebec bearing 63.1°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Tripoli, Peloponnese bearing 137.6° or SE .
- Tripoli, Peloponnese has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Nitchequon, Quebec has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Tripoli, Peloponnese is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Nitchequon, Quebec is in or near the subpolar rain tundra biome.
- The average temperature is 18.3 °C (32.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 17.7 °C (31.9°F) less in Tripoli, Peloponnese.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 16.3 mm (0.6 in) less which is equivalent to 16.3 l/m² (0.4 US gal/ft²) or 163,000 l/ha (17,426 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 15.7° higher in Tripoli, Peloponnese than in Nitchequon, Quebec.
- Relative humidity levels are 12.8%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 14.5°C (26.2°F) higher.
